Energy

AG1 contains B vitamins like B6 and B12 that support your energy metabolism and help reduce tiredness.◊

Immune system

Vitamin C from citrus fruits and minerals like zinc and selenium support your immune function.◊

Focus

AG1 supports mental performance with pantothenic acid and cognitive function with zinc.◊

Digestion

Calcium supports digestive enzymes, while biotin contributes to the maintenance of the gut lining.◊

Dr. Ralph Esposito

ND, Lac — Functional Medicine

Dr. Esposito is a licensed naturopathic physician focused on optimizing healthspan and lifespan through preventive and lifestyle practices. He completed his training as a medical intern in Urology at NYU Langone, holds a clinical Masters in Acupuncture and Chinese Medicine, and is a certified Functional Medicine doctor (IFMCP). Dr. Esposito employs evidence-based tactics to provide a personalized approach to preventative medicine. He is active in the health and education sectors, and is an Adjunct Professor in the Nutrition and Dietetics Program at New York University alongside his role as Chief Science & Nutrition Officer at AG1.

Dr. Sonia Malani

ND, FABNO — Integrative Medicine

Dr. Malani is a licensed naturopathic physician and board-certified integrative oncologist, author, and researcher. She earned her naturopathic medicine doctorate from Bastyr University, following a B.A. in psychology from New York University. Dr. Malani has over a decade of experience supporting patients with cancer and chronic illnesses. She is a contributing author to Ann Berger’s 5th Edition of Principles and Practice of Palliative Care and Supportive Oncology and has conducted multiple clinical trials exploring the effectiveness of integrative medicine with a focus on epigenetics, oncology, nutrition, and psychoneuroimmunology. She is currently the Senior Manager of Scientific Communication and Education at AG1.

Dr. Jeremy Townsend

PhD — Exercise Physiology

Dr. Townsend earned his doctoral degree in Exercise Physiology from the University of Central Florida and has published over 80 peer-reviewed research articles focusing on sport nutrition, exercise performance, skeletal muscle physiology, and dietary supplementation. He has given numerous presentations and talks on nutrition and dietary supplementation at international conferences. Dr. Townsend is a Certified Sport Nutritionist (CISSN) through the International Society of Sport Nutrition (ISSN) and a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ist with Distinction (CSCS*D) through the National Strength and Conditioning Association (NSCA). Dr. Townsend is currently the Research Manager at AG1 and an Adjunct Professor at Concordia University Chicago.
